Transaction 4231dc56dddfa487a7db4fc642984248f57d7f72abcf8ffd2318d337ff94ad11

6 Input
2 Outputs
  • 4231dc56dddfa487a7db4fc642984248f57d7f72abcf8ffd2318d337ff94ad11:0
  • value  51833246
    address  3K4PHBUpNyYrrzgm9Y8dUaiWeKnyHyDy5A
  • 4231dc56dddfa487a7db4fc642984248f57d7f72abcf8ffd2318d337ff94ad11:1
  • value  87759
    address  3ANejs1HowAmghoDsxgYqKpagYBNuDuS9F